Shopping

In Tai Hang, explore Causeway Bay Shopping Plaza for a vibrant mix of shops, just 435m away. K11 Art Mall and Pacific Place, both 1.2km away, offer a fantastic blend of business and entertainment. If you're up for a drive, discover more shopping centres further afield.

Recreation

Victoria Park offers a tranquil retreat with lush greenery, perfect for leisurely strolls and relaxation. Nearby, Hong Kong Stadium buzzes with sports energy, ideal for active enthusiasts. For families, Middle Road Children’s Playground provides an outdoor haven filled with fun and laughter, fostering joyful moments for all ages.

Adventure

Experience the Wan Chai Green Trail, a scenic outdoor adventure located 621m from Tai Hang, perfect for nature enthusiasts. For a splash of fun, visit Water World Ocean Park, 1.9km away, offering thrilling rides and family entertainment. Don’t miss the Hong Pak Country Trail, 621m away, ideal for hiking amidst stunning scenery.

Best time to go to Tai Hang

The best time to visit Tai Hang is dependant on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July and August are its hottest month on average. At the time of August,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ly sunny with no rain (dry).

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January62.1°F (16.7°C)No Rain (Dry)Most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
February64.6°F (18.1°C)No Rain (Dry)Mostly CloudyAverageAverage
March69.1°F (20.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
April73.8°F (23.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
May79.3°F (26.3°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
June82.9°F (28.3°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
July84.2°F (29.0°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ly Low
August84.2°F (29.0°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
September82.9°F (28.3°C)Moderate R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
October78.1°F (25.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
November72.1°F (22.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
December64.0°F (17.8°C)No Rain (Dry)Most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ly High

The nearest major airports for your trip to Tai Hang

When visiting Tai Hang, Hong Kong, the main airport to consider is Hong Kong International Airport (HKG), situated 10.6km away. Excellent hotel options nearby include the Regal Airport Hotel, a 5-star establishment just 186m from the airport, and the Hong Kong SkyCity Marriott Hotel, a 4.5-star hotel 311m away, both providing easy airport access. Shenzhen International Airport (SZX) is another option, located 21.7km away, with the luxurious Baolilai International Hotel just 1.2km from it. For those considering Zhuhai, Jinwan Airport (ZUH) lies 34.8km away, featuring hotels like Zhuhaichimelong Hengqin Bay Hotel, which is 11.2km from the airport, offering shuttle services on request.
